  38. Yeah we always have to remember it's the a-league. It's so rare for a side to have a starting 11 without issues in some positions.Impossible even. Milanovic frustrates me too, but he's young and there's at least a small chance still he will not follow the Arzani path of always remaining a selfish git. But look at it - he's in the top scorers list in the league, despite all the frustrations, and we have what, the 2nd best goal difference, despite all the opportunities he wastes. He is a big part of the dynamic because he takes players on and they have to deal with it. If he wasn't doing that there'd be fewer failures because there'd be fewer opportunities. And teams would feel much more comfortable defending against us, meaning that they'd mess up less, even if it's not Milanovic directly contributing in the end. i know what i'd prefer. And look at the last time we won domestic silverware. Dino Kresinger, what was it, 1 goal in the regular season, I think. He created problems though, that was the point of him. If there was a genuine replacement that was an upgrade and ready to go, in form, and we could get him early in the peace with a strong chance of firing, I'm not going to say no. But what actually happens in the a-league - and with us especially - is we get rid of a player and replace them with someone who has just as many frustrations. But they have to "gel" or whatever all over again. Keep the band together I say.
